Anton was born in Auckland NZ, and turned 30 on 26th October 2018.

Anton ended his own life on November 29th 2018. A really confused young man with a beautiful soul, who got torn apart by the 'system' He is just another 'statistic' for Mental Health in NZ.

At 14 years of age, Anton got into all kinds of minor 'scrapes' with his local friends, and regretfully for his Mother, he was put into a CYFS Home for boys. This was to change his life forever.

During his time in this home Anton was physically, sexually and mentally abused.

On the odd day he was allowed to spend with his family, he was forced into 'stealing' specific items from them, and take them back to the 'home'. If he came back empty handed, he had to suffer all kinds of harsh punishment from the boys and the 'Carer'..

He was made to 'run the gauntlet' between the larger boys, and get beaten on his way.

He suffered cigarette burns, beatings, sexual abuse and was too frightened to tell anyone what he was going through. Anton was threatened with all kinds of repercussions if he 'narked'.

It was not until another boy ran away from the home and told his parents what was happening, that Anton's torment at the home came to an end and the home was closed down by the Govt. .

His story made full front page news in the NZ Herald, with his photo splashed all over the front cover. He felt humiliated and embarrassed and never forgave those who had put him in this

naughty boys home'. It affected him mentally for the rest of his life and his life changed forever.

He became a difficult, unhappy, unforgiving young man. It seemed to him that once all the furore was over, he was thrown in the 'left over' heap to fend for himself.

When Anton died he was in his Mother and Grandparents care, being on 3 months Home detention at their Christchurch property. It was during this time that he started to work out, improve his attitude, and take an interest in his future. He had some wonderful plans and was eagerly waiting to start Counselling - which regretfully never eventuated. Not his fault - again the NZ Mental Health system let him down.

Anton really needed help - a lot of help - but never got what he needed in life.
